Brandied-Bacony Chicken

2 rasher streky Bacon
1.25kg Chicken
60ml Brandy

  1. Preheat oven 220c/Gas mark 7

  2. In a small frying pan cook bacon over a medium heat until its crisp and the pan is full of lovey bacony fat, about 4 minutes.

  3. Take the pan off the heat, then remove the bacon and put straight into the cavity of the chicken, sitting the chicken breast side up, in a roasting tin as you do so.

  4. Pour the brandy into the still hot pan and let it bubble for a minute with the bacon fat.

  5. Pour the brandy mixture over the chicken, place in the hot oven and roast until cooked.

She said 45min but hers didn't looked cooked .
